Transaction 22fcf824ef91f9755f3a88d7123a2f80e2a96f4e44eb6872b4bcc5dd64bfed89
2 Input
2 Outputs
- 22fcf824ef91f9755f3a88d7123a2f80e2a96f4e44eb6872b4bcc5dd64bfed89:0
- 22fcf824ef91f9755f3a88d7123a2f80e2a96f4e44eb6872b4bcc5dd64bfed89:1
value 51899
address 1MZfPgjxsN39x2Qp7162vLWUKoYMVtuS5k
value 28109717
address 18YEwk9KAZ3A8owrRsgjAe1YDtE7W3S6Jw